[Wine] wine-0.9.2 compile problems under suse10-x86_64

Hartmut Wziontek hwz at hwz.bv.TU-Berlin.DE
Tue Dec 6 06:07:48 CST 2005

hello all, 

cannot compile wine Version 0.9.2 under suse10-x86_64, neither from source
nor from the src-rpm. there must be some trouble between libraries:

../../tools/winegcc/winegcc -B../../tools/winebuild -shared ./ddraw.spec    clip
per.o ddraw_hal.o ddraw_main.o ddraw_thunks.o ddraw_user.o ddraw_utils.o main.o 
palette_hal.o palette_main.o regsvr.o surface_dib.o surface_fakezbuffer.o surfac
e_gamma.o surface_hal.o surface_main.o surface_thunks.o surface_user.o surface_w
ndproc.o  version.res   -o ddraw.dll.so -L../../dlls -L../../dlls/ole32 -L../../
dlls/user32 -L../../dlls/gdi32 -L../../dlls/advapi32 -L../../dlls/kernel32 -lole
32 -luser32 -lgdi32 -ladvapi32 -lkernel32  -L../../libs/wine -lwine -ldxguid -lu
uid  -L/usr/X11R6/lib64  -lXext -lX11   -L../../libs/port -lwine_port  
/usr/lib64/gcc/x86_64-suse-linux/4.0.2/../../../../x86_64-suse-linux/bin/ld: ski
pping incompatible /usr/X11R6/lib64/libXext.so when searching for -lXext
/usr/lib64/gcc/x86_64-suse-linux/4.0.2/../../../../x86_64-suse-linux/bin/ld: ski
pping incompatible /usr/X11R6/lib64/libXext.a when searching for -lXext
/usr/lib64/gcc/x86_64-suse-linux/4.0.2/../../../../x86_64-suse-linux/bin/ld: can
not find -lXext
collect2: ld returned 1 exit status
winegcc: gcc failed.
make[2]: *** [ddraw.dll.so] Fehler 2
make[2]: Leaving directory `/usr/src/packages/BUILD/wine-0.9.2/dlls/ddraw'
make[1]: *** [ddraw] Fehler 2
make[1]: Leaving directory `/usr/src/packages/BUILD/wine-0.9.2/dlls'
make: *** [dlls] Fehler 2
error: Bad exit status from /var/tmp/rpm-tmp.75894 (%build)

library libXext.a exists in /usr/X11R6/lib (32bit?) and  /usr/X11R6/lib64
have no idea what to do...

cheers - hartmut

More information about the wine-users mailing list